Output 10bb400f853698076136831cd62cd6237980b0de350ccd122134c3d6dc273017:4

value
95912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ea92c2b160d1a79c874bf7e5fe37c6034e77bc6d OP_EQUAL
address
3P5KrXnuc9AwnBG8oRwZs6K7Yd7uTxSc5e
transaction
10bb400f853698076136831cd62cd6237980b0de350ccd122134c3d6dc273017
confirmations
127779
spent
true